Bio
There is a gap in our understanding of how the precise organization of cells in the nervous system (e.g. neural cells) impacts human behavior and disease. The Smith lab’s goal is to address this by understanding how stem cells and other cell populations build and rebuild the nervous system. Using advanced imaging approaches with molecular and cellular biology techniques we have the opportunity to reveal new biological processes that occur during development and regeneration of the nervous system, investigate the blueprint and construction of those processes and then discover the overall behavioral impact of disrupting such biology, helping us gain insight into how diseases manifest themselves in the clinic.
